Durability and Strength
One of the foremost benefits of metal grate trailer flooring is its unparalleled durability. Unlike traditional wooden or composite materials, metal grates are impervious to moisture, pests, and rot. This resilience ensures that the flooring remains intact even under heavy loads and extreme environmental conditions. The robust construction of metal grating can withstand significant wear and tear, making it ideal for trailers that transport heavy machinery, construction materials, or hazardous goods.
Moreover, metal grate flooring is designed to handle substantial weight without buckling or deforming, offering a reliable solution for transporting valuable cargo. This strength not only enhances the longevity of the trailer but also contributes to the overall safety of the load being carried.
Safety Features
Safety is paramount in the transportation industry, and metal grate flooring offers several features that enhance its safety profile. The non-slip surface of metal grates provides excellent traction, reducing the risk of slips and falls for workers loading and unloading cargo. This is especially advantageous in wet or oily conditions where traditional flooring materials may become dangerously slick.
Additionally, the design of metal grates allows for efficient drainage of liquids, preventing the accumulation of water or other hazardous substances that could create hazardous work environments. This drainage feature is particularly beneficial in industries where spills or leaks are a common occurrence.
Low Maintenance Costs
Maintaining trailer flooring can be a significant expense for transportation companies. However, metal grate flooring significantly reduces maintenance costs. Its resistance to corrosion and mechanical damage means that it requires less frequent repairs or replacements compared to traditional flooring options. Cleaning is also simpler; most contaminants can be easily washed away, and the robust nature of the metal means there is less risk of damage during the cleaning process.
Furthermore, metal grates do not harbor bacteria or mold, which can be a concern with wooden floors. This hygienic aspect is especially critical for companies transporting food products, chemicals, or other sensitive materials.
Versatility and Customization
Metal grate flooring is versatile and can be customized to fit various trailer designs and requirements. Different materials such as aluminum or steel can be used, allowing companies to choose a flooring solution that best meets their specific needs, whether it be weight considerations, load type, or environmental conditions.
Additionally, the modular design of metal grates allows for easy installation and replacement, which can minimize downtime during trailer maintenance and operation. This flexibility ensures that companies can swiftly adapt their trailers for diverse cargo types without extensive modifications.
